Word 表中的公式错误 =SUM(ABOVE)

Att*_*tie 2 worksheet-function microsoft-word

我刚刚发现,在特定情况下,=SUM(ABOVE)公式会出现错误......至少据我所知,它的行为错误......

生成一个 3x3 表格,将左下角的两个单元格合并并填充,如下所示:

表格布局

不管你相信与否,这个方程将会得出5......2 + 3

表结果

我已经通过更改这些值确认了这一点,并且更多合并的列似乎加剧了这个问题。


以下都将3产生正确的结果:

  • 删除合并
  • 删除顶行
  • 直接在上面插入一行 - 注意:其中有或没有数字
  • 在顶行插入一个数字
  • 2在和之间插入一个空列3- 注意:其中没有数字

我是否遗漏了什么,或者我们在使用合并单元格和公式时是否必须非常小心?

还有比ABOVE在这里使用更正确的东西吗?

我用的是Word 2013。


我现在的解决方案是简单地避免合并单元格,并保持列数始终相同 - 即使它们没有对齐:

未对齐的列

Ric*_*els 5

是的,合并的细胞会扰乱它的思维。使用特定细胞编号的替代方法。

在此输入图像描述

如果您想将“ABOVE”与显式单元格引用混合使用,则公式可能如下所示:

{ =SUM(ABOVE+A2) }在上面的示例中,求和值将变为4。可以用这种方式进行简单的加法或减法。有一个用于乘法和除法的 PRODUCT 函数。

ABOVE 函数有一些限制,包括在遇到空白单元格或包含文本的单元格时停止。有关对整列数字求和以及解决函数限制的更多信息,请参阅 Word MVP 网站上一篇文章的链接,标题为“如何使用公式对整个表格列求和,即使表格中的某些单元格也如此”。列包含文本或为空。